Recall History (2 recalls)

87V164000Dec 1987

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:WIRING:FRONT UNDERHOOD

ENGINE COMPARTMENT WIRING HARNESS FUSIBLE LINK WIRES MAY BE TRAPPED UNDER THE SPEED CONTROL SERVO BRACKET.

91V051000Dec 1991

STEERING: STEERING WHEEL/HANDLE BAR

THE STEERING WHEEL MAY CRACK AT ITS MOUNTING HUB WELD ATTACHMENT BECAUSE OF FATIGUE LOADING AND EVENTUALLY SEPARATE FROM THE HUB.
